What problems can show up if the land is not prepared correctly?

Poor prep leads to surface cracking, uneven settling, standing water, and heaving from freeze-thaw cycles. These problems shorten the court’s lifespan and create trip hazards. Fixing them after the surface is laid costs significantly more than addressing them during the prep phase.

What if my yard has hidden drainage or soil problems?

Hidden issues like clay layers, high water tables, or buried organic material are identified during the on-site evaluation through visual inspection and probing. If something unexpected surfaces during construction, the scope is reviewed and you are informed before work continues, nothing is buried under the base without being addressed.

How much grading or leveling does my site need?

Grading depth depends on existing slope, soil type, and how much material needs to be cut or filled. The on-site evaluation determines the exact scope, and the cost is broken out in your written estimate. Most court sites require a consistent 1% cross-slope for drainage, which guides how much leveling is needed.

Do I need site prep if my yard already looks flat?

Yes, a yard that looks flat to the eye can still have grade variations, soft spots, or drainage issues that will damage a court over time. An on-site evaluation checks actual slope, soil compaction, and water flow before any work begins. Visual flatness is not the same as court-ready ground.

How do you make sure the court fits the space I have?

During the on-site evaluation, the space is measured against the required court dimensions plus buffer zones for fencing and run-off. If the area is tight, placement and orientation are adjusted to make the best use of what is available before any ground is disturbed.

Can any flat area be used for a court?

Not automatically. The area also needs adequate load-bearing soil, proper drainage, and enough clearance around the playing surface. Some sites need significant sub-base work or drainage correction before they are suitable. The on-site evaluation determines whether a given area can support a court and what prep is required.

How do you decide where the court should be placed on my property?

Placement is decided during the on-site evaluation based on available space, natural drainage direction, sun orientation, setback requirements, and proximity to utilities. Courts oriented north-south reduce glare during play. Those factors are weighed together to find the position that works best for your specific lot.

Will site prep be enough if my ground is soft or stays wet?

Soft or persistently wet ground needs more than standard grading. It typically requires sub-drain installation, a deeper compacted aggregate base, or geotextile fabric to stabilize the sub-grade. The on-site evaluation identifies the severity, and the written estimate outlines the specific measures needed for your site.

Do you need different site prep for sloped lots in the foothills and mountain-valley areas?

Yes. Sloped lots in areas like Botetourt County or the Cave Spring foothills often require cut-and-fill grading, retaining walls, or stepped sub-base construction that flat suburban lots do not. The steeper the natural grade, the more earthwork is needed to achieve the tight tolerances a court surface requires.

Do I need a court-specific crew, or can a general labor crew do the prep?

Court prep requires sport-specific tolerances, typically a 1% slope for drainage with no more than a quarter-inch variation across the surface. A general labor crew grading to landscaping standards will not hit those tolerances consistently, which leads to drainage failures and surface problems after the court is laid.

What does court site preparation include?

Site prep covers clearing vegetation and debris, grading and compacting the sub-base, addressing drainage, and bringing the ground to the correct slope and bearing capacity for the court surface. Every project starts with an on-site evaluation, and the scope is detailed in a written itemised estimate before work begins.

What is the first step before building a court?

The first step is an on-site evaluation of the space, soil, and drainage. That assessment drives every decision that follows, placement, grading depth, drainage design, and base specification. Nothing is quoted or scheduled until that evaluation is complete.

Will you check for drainage problems before the court is built?

Yes. Drainage assessment is part of every on-site evaluation. The site is reviewed for natural water flow, low spots, and soil permeability. Any drainage corrections needed are included in the itemised written estimate so there are no surprises once construction starts.

Will you remove trees, brush, rocks, or old material before building?

Clearing vegetation, rocks, and existing surface material is part of site prep. The on-site evaluation identifies what needs to come out, and the written estimate specifies what clearing work is included. Large tree removal with stump grinding may be scoped separately depending on the site.

How long does site prep usually take before the court build starts?

Most residential site prep takes two to five days, depending on how much clearing, grading, and drainage work the site needs. Larger or more complex sites take longer. Your written estimate will include a projected timeline so you know what to expect before work begins.

How do you prepare drainage-sensitive soil before court construction starts?

Drainage-sensitive soil, typically clay-heavy ground common across the Roanoke Valley, is addressed with sub-drain trenches, a compacted crushed-stone base layer, and in some cases geotextile fabric to separate the stone from the native soil. The specific combination depends on what the on-site evaluation finds.

Will seasonal rain change the site prep schedule?

Heavy rain can delay grading and compaction because wet soil cannot be compacted to the required density. Work is paused when ground conditions fall below spec rather than pushing through and compromising the base. Your project timeline accounts for typical seasonal weather, and any delays are communicated as they arise.

Will clay soil or sloped terrain in Roanoke add work to the project?

Clay soil needs deeper sub-base compaction and careful drainage routing to prevent water retention. Sloped terrain requires grading to bring the court area to a consistent, controlled angle. Both are common in the Roanoke Valley and are accounted for in the site evaluation.

Will the site prep help keep the court from settling later?

Yes, when done correctly. Proper compaction of the sub-base and a well-designed drainage layer are the two main factors that prevent settling. Skipping or rushing either step is the most common reason courts develop low spots and cracks within a few years of installation.

How do you keep the court from ending up uneven or too small?

Accurate measurement during the evaluation sets the layout before any ground is moved. Grade is checked throughout the compaction process, not just at the end. A final walkthrough is completed before the job is signed off to confirm dimensions and surface tolerance meet the required specification.
